Output 6ec8dbb82eb4db439dfded842ea3a14a5f81f460aff0e26a1131c3b617ac4f4c:1

value
406426532336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d20145dc95579675b7ee65f7c162e2975ac31726 OP_EQUAL
address
2NCPdR1aX3b6EuGc31WnEnscgUGyeUCZc2D
transaction
6ec8dbb82eb4db439dfded842ea3a14a5f81f460aff0e26a1131c3b617ac4f4c